Real Madrid striker Kylian Mbappe says coach Alvaro Arbeloa told him he was the “fourth player” in the squad before he was benched against Real Oviedo.
The France captain returned from a thigh problem in Thursday’s 2-0 win over Oviedo, but his appearance as a 69th-minute substitute was met with a whistle from Madrid’s own side. disgruntled agents at the Santiago Bernabeu.

Arbeloa started with Vinicius Junior, Franco Mastantuono and Gonzalo Garcia against Oviedo, with Mbappe out for almost three weeks.
“I am very well, 100 percent, I did not play because the coach told me that for him I am the fourth player in the team, behind Mastantuono, Vinicius and Gonzalo,” Mbappe told reporters after the match.
The striker received an assist and passed to Jude Bellingham, also a substitute, for Madrid’s second goal.
“In the end, I accept (being on the bench), and I play when I have to play,” said the striker.

Madrid coach Arbeloa said in his press conference after the match that he did not tell Mbappe that he had stopped following.
“Maybe they misunderstood me. I don’t know what to tell you,” Arbeloa told reporters.
“For me it is clear that a player who four days ago could not even make the bench in a game, should not start today, especially because this is not the last, it is not a life or death game…
“Also because we have a game on Sunday where he will be the first choice forward, as I told him.”
Arbeloa said he could understand Mbappe, who has scored 41 goals in 42 games this season, not being happy.
“I can understand that Kylian Mbappe is not happy today because he didn’t play, but it’s a decision based, as I said, on what happened and, as I said before, I don’t want to risk anything,” the coach added.
Madrid’s season has been difficult, with coach Xabi Alonso replaced by Arbeloa in January.
With Barca having sealed the La Liga title, Los Blancos will end a second year in a row without a major trophy, and president Florentino Perez has called for an election.
